About the Artist
Kunio Kaneko (b. 1949) is a Tokyo-based printmaker whose work blends postwar mokuhanga tradition with quiet, contemporary warmth. A student of Joichi Hoshi and Sasajima Kihei, he developed a distinctive style enriched with gold and silver leaf, featuring recurring motifs such as koi, koinobori, Fuji, kimono, tabi, and geta. His prints reflect a desire to communicate love and human connection through the handmade image.
